Getting Started

To begin revolutionizing your support experience, you need to install HelpHub on your website. This powerful tool allows you to provide seamless customer service to your users. The first step in the installation process is to download the HelpHub plugin from the official website.

Once you have downloaded the plugin, you can upload it to your WordPress dashboard. Simply navigate to the Plugins section and click on the “Add New” button. From there, you can upload the HelpHub plugin and activate it on your site.

Creating Support Articles

One of the key features of HelpHub is its ability to create and manage support articles. These articles act as a knowledge base for your customers, allowing them to find answers to common questions and issues on their own.

To create support articles, simply navigate to the HelpHub dashboard and click on the “Add New Article” button. From there, you can write detailed guides, FAQs, troubleshooting steps, and more to assist your customers in resolving their queries.

Implementing Automated Responses

Another powerful feature of HelpHub is its ability to provide automated responses to common customer queries. You can set up predefined responses for frequently asked questions, allowing your customers to receive instant assistance without having to wait for a support agent.

To implement automated responses, navigate to the HelpHub settings and create response templates for different query types. You can also set up keyword triggers to automatically match customer queries with the appropriate response.
